Senior HR Business Partner

About the role

This role will play a critical role in supporting a company in a phase of rapid growth and expansion, ensuring that people operations scale effectively while remaining fully aligned with labor law and regulatory requirements.

As a Senior HR Business Partner, you will act as a trusted advisor to business leaders, combining hands-on HR execution with strategic people partnering and deep expertise in labor law and compliance. You will ensure that all people-related decisions, policies, and processes evolve in line with business needs while maintaining strong legal and regulatory alignment.

This position will be responsible for managing the full employee lifecycle, advising leaders on complex people matters, and proactively identifying and mitigating labor and compliance risks. The ideal candidate is business-oriented, highly organized, and confident navigating complex employee relations, collective frameworks, and regulatory environments within a fast-moving organization.

You will work closely with managers, senior leadership, and external legal advisors to ensure that HR practices support sustainable growth, operational excellence, and full compliance, acting both as a strategic business partner and a guardian of best labor practices during the company's expansion journey.

Key Responsibilities

  • Act as a strategic HR Business Partner to business leaders, providing guidance on people strategy, organizational design, workforce planning, and change management in a fast-growing and evolving environment.

  • Ensure full compliance with labor laws and regulatory requirements, staying up to date with legal changes and proactively translating them into practical HR policies, processes, and recommendations.

  • Manage and oversee the full employee lifecycle, including onboarding, performance management, employee development, promotions, exits, and disciplinary processes.

  • Advise and support managers on complex employee relations matters, including performance issues, conflicts, disciplinary actions, terminations, and sensitive cases, ensuring fair treatment and legal alignment.

  • Identify, assess, and mitigate labor and compliance risks, working closely with external legal advisors when needed to ensure sound decision-making.

  • Lead the implementation and continuous improvement of HR policies, procedures, and internal controls, ensuring consistency, scalability, and compliance as the company grows.

  • Partner with leadership to support organizational growth and expansion, including new roles, new teams, and potential geographic expansion, ensuring HR frameworks are fit for scale.

  • Support managers in building a high-performing, engaged, and positive work environment, balancing business needs with employee experience.

  • Act as a point of reference for labor law interpretation and best practices, providing training and guidance to managers on people management and compliance-related topics.

  • Collaborate with People Operations, Talent, and other internal stakeholders to ensure alignment between people strategy, operational execution, and legal requirements.

  • Own and develop HR data, reporting, and people metrics to track the impact of HR initiatives, employee lifecycle management, and compliance-related actions.

  • Provide regular and ad-hoc reporting to leadership on key people indicators such as headcount, attrition, absenteeism, performance trends, employee relations cases, and labor risk exposure.

  • Use people data to support decision-making, identify trends, anticipate risks, and propose data-driven recommendations aligned with business objectives.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Labor Relations, Psychology, Law, or a related field.

  • 5+ years of experience in a combination of HR Generalist, HR Business Partner, or Employee Relations roles.

  • Strong knowledge of labor law and employment regulations; legal or labor law background is highly preferred.

  • Proven experience advising managers and leadership on people-related and organizational matters.

  • Experience handling employee relations, disciplinary processes, and terminations.

  • Ability to balance business needs with legal compliance and employee well-being.

  • Strong communication, negotiation, and conflict-resolution skills.

  • High level of discretion, integrity, and professional judgment.

  • Ability to work in a fast-paced, evolving environment and manage multiple priorities.

  • Fluency in English; additional languages are a plus.
